The Velodysee, Atlantic coast from the North to the South

The famous cycle path that runs along the Atlantic coast from north to south, stops at the Bay of Arcachon.

77 km of cycle paths connect the essential sites of the Bay of Arcachon.

From Dune du Pilat to Cap-Ferret

From the Dune-du-Pilat to the Cap-Ferret lighthouse, via the Domaine de Certes et Graveyron in Audenge, the beautiful villas from Taussat to Lanton, or the small port of Biganos, the Vélodyssée has more than one route to explore.

Tour of The Hearth of the Bassin d’Arcachon

For a more challenging outing, the tour of the Bay can be done in a day. The relatively flat route lets you discover a multitude of different landscapes. Take the boat from Lège-Cap-Ferret to reach Arcachon! This route can be done just as well in “slow life” mode, with overnights, to take the time to discover the surroundings. Head off with your swimsuit and towel, good shoes and a cap, and criss-cross the cycle paths to discover the region. With its oyster ports, typical villages and pine forests, you can discover the Bay at your own pace…!
